The grant can assist with start-up costs such as licensing and training fees, purchasing supplies and toys, making minor modifications to a property (such as fencing in a backyard) required to license the property as a childcare facility, and assisting with the providers cash flow in the early stages of operating a childcare facility. The Child Care Development Block Grant Act provides federal funding to states for child care subsidies for low-income families.
